Jeanie Cheek, a multifaceted individual with a diverse range of creative pursuits, has made a notable impact in the entertainment industry through her work on several projects.

One of her most prominent credits is her contribution to the anthology horror film V/H/S, released in 2012. This collaborative effort brought together a talented group of filmmakers to create a unique and thrilling cinematic experience.

In addition to her work on V/H/S, Cheek has also been involved in the production of the 2004 film Burning Annie. project This showcases her versatility as a filmmaker and her ability to adapt to different genres and styles.

Moreover, Cheek has also made a name for herself in the realm of television, particularly with her work on the children's educational series The Who Was? Show, which premiered in 2018. This show is a testament to her ability to create engaging and informative content for a young audience.

Throughout her career, Jeanie Cheek has demonstrated her talent and dedication to her craft, leaving a lasting impression on the entertainment industry.
